Practice Reading Passage: Renewable Energy Adoption in Remote Areas

Passage

Renewable energy technology (RET) has the potential to transform energy access in remote areas. Traditional energy infrastructure is often costly and challenging to extend to isolated regions, leaving many rural communities without reliable power sources. Renewable energy sources such as solar, wind, and hydropower offer a viable alternative.

Paragraph 1:
Solar energy, for example, can be harnessed locally using photovoltaic panels. These panels convert sunlight directly into electricity, making them especially useful in sunny regions where conventional power grids are inaccessible. They provide an independent power source that does not rely on fuel deliveries or extensive grid infrastructure.

Paragraph 2:
Wind energy is another renewable resource being utilized in remote regions. Wind turbines can generate electricity as long as there is a consistent wind flow. The scalability of wind farms, ranging from small personal turbines to large-scale installations, makes them adaptable to various geographical and climatic conditions.

Paragraph 3:
Hydropower also holds promise, especially in areas with abundant water resources. Micro-hydropower systems can generate electricity for small communities by utilizing the kinetic energy of flowing water. These systems are less intrusive to the environment compared to large-scale dams and can be installed in streams and rivers without significant ecological disruption.

Paragraph 4:
The adoption of renewable energy in remote areas not only provides reliable electricity but also promotes socio-economic development. It facilitates better educational and healthcare services by ensuring consistent power supply to schools and clinics. Additionally, renewable energy reduces the dependency on expensive and polluting fossil fuels, contributing to environmental sustainability.

Paragraph 5:
Despite these advantages, several challenges remain. Initial investment costs for renewable energy systems can be high, and there may be a lack of technical expertise in local communities. Furthermore, maintenance of these systems can be difficult without proper training. Governments and international organizations are crucial in providing financial assistance and technical support to overcome these obstacles.

Common Mistakes and How to Avoid Them

One of the frequent challenges students face in the Reading section is misinterpreting the question requirements, leading to incorrect answers. To overcome this, carefully read the question and understand what it is asking for. Pay close attention to the wording and don’t let similar-looking options confuse you. Practice regularly with a variety of question types to become familiar with the nuances.

Vocabulary and Grammar Highlights

Vocabulary:

  • Photovoltaic (adj) /ˌfəʊtəʊˈvɒl.teɪ.ɪk/: relating to the conversion of light into electricity.
  • Turbine (noun) /ˈtɜː.bɪn/: a machine for producing continuous power.
  • Kinetic (adj) /kɪˈnɛtɪk/: relating to or resulting from motion.
  • Scalability (noun) /ˌskeɪ.ləˈbɪl.ɪ.ti/: the capacity to be changed in size or scale.

Grammar:

  • Relative Clauses: “These panels, which convert sunlight directly into electricity, are particularly useful in sunny regions.”
  • Passive Voice: “Solar energy can be harnessed locally using photovoltaic panels.”
